Transaction ecd3a60e34a813ee66dfc8846e01d1b13147a927e1ebc8f9a86fe0cef50209b5

2 Input
2 Outputs
  • ecd3a60e34a813ee66dfc8846e01d1b13147a927e1ebc8f9a86fe0cef50209b5:0
  • value  28975429
    address  3KkY8M2h118b2zS1dJXDZ6MJffCsHCRGVB
  • ecd3a60e34a813ee66dfc8846e01d1b13147a927e1ebc8f9a86fe0cef50209b5:1
  • value  1989250515
    address  3BRpfecfDp2EfdNN76rPGDcd5oKvBzYQhy